Problems solved by technology

[0002] With the advancement of urbanization, more and more people live in high-rise buildings. Since the high-rise buildings are basically connected with natural gas, people mainly use natural gas as fuel for cooking. As we all know, natural gas is mainly composed of alkanes, of which methane It accounts for the vast majority, and there is a small amount of ethane, propane and butane. In addition, there are generally hydrogen sulfide, carbon dioxide, nitrogen and water vapor, a small amount of carbon monoxide and traces of rare gases. Among them, carbon monoxide is poisonous. Once natural gas leaks, it is very likely to It is easy to cause carbon monoxide poisoning in people. Once carbon monoxide poisoning, if the patients with carbon monoxide poisoning cannot be sent to the emergency department for inhalation of hyperbaric oxygen in time, it will increase the incidence of dementia, stupor, paralysis, sensory movement disorders or peripheral neuropathy in patients with carbon monoxide poisoning. The probability of neuropsychiatric complications, however, the current treatment bed used in emergency medicine does not have the function of providing hyperbaric oxygen, and other functions are relatively simple. Therefore, a multifunctional treatment bed for emergency medicine is proposed

Embodiment 2

[0067]The difference from Example 1 is that the upper surface of the bed board 1 is also provided with an anti-skid layer, and the anti-skid layer is prepared by the following method:

[0068] Take the following raw materials and weigh them by weight: 25 parts of epoxy resin, 13 parts of quartz powder, 40 parts of methanol, 5 parts of polyamide resin, 5 parts of titanium dioxide powder, 6 parts of zinc phosphate powder, 2 parts of p-phenylenediamine, diethyl 3 parts of thiourea and 3 parts of paraffin oil;

[0069] S1. Put the weighed epoxy resin, quartz powder, polyamide resin, titanium dioxide powder and zinc phosphate powder into the ball mill for fine grinding until the particle diameter is 20um to obtain a mixed powder material;

[0070] S2. Add the mixed powder material and methanol prepared in step S1 into a blender and stir for 20 minutes, and the stirring speed of the blender is set to 600r / min;

Abstract

The invention discloses a multifunctional treatment bed for emergency internal medicine, which comprises a bed plate which is horizontally arranged, a placing device is arranged on one side of the bedplate, close to the edge, four legs are symmetrically arranged at the bottom corners of the bed plate, and universal wheels are arranged at the bottom ends of the four legs, one side of the upper part of a supporting plate is provided with an oxygen supply device, and the other side of the upper part of the supporting plate is provided with a power supply device. The device is convenient to use,can be used for classifying and placing some articles required to rescue, brings convenience to patients and medical personnel, facilitates knowing the heart rate of a patient by the medical personnelin real time, can stably provide hyperbaric oxygen for patients with carbon monoxide poisoning, can be used for effectively reducing the probability of delayed neuropsy chiatric seguelea of the patients with carbon monoxide poisoning, such as dementia stupor mental disorder, paralysis agitans syndrome, sensory dyskinesia or peripheral neuropathy and the like, effectively improves the cure rate ofpatients with carbon monoxide poisoning, and is worthy of promotion and popularization.
